MKE are pleased to announce the recent purchase of assets pertaining to

Geisler - a leading, London based balancing company.

For almost 100 years, Giesler performed rotor balancing services

in-house and on customer sites. MKE have installed equipment

from Giesler into the Sittingbourne workshop as well as taken on

additional staff to bolster service provision in this area. In

addition, MKE will also manufacture & distribute Giesler’s custom

horizontal balancing machines enabling balancing of rotors

ranging in weight from10gms to 24 tonnes.

Operations Manager, Shaun Stickings commented: “The

acquisition of Giesler’s assets and personnel represents another

significant investment in the expansion of MKE Engineering

Group, we are pleased to welcome the expertise into the MKE

family. This development further increases our ability to offer the

very highest quality of repair and level of service to our

customers.”

Southern Water renew framework agreement

MKE’s long standing relationship with Southern Water continues with the renewal of the framework agreement for a

further 3 years up to 2015. This agreement encompasses all areas of motor, drive and pump repair across the Southern

Water network .

MKE personnel are also on hand 24 hours a day, 365 days of the year in order to deal with emergency callouts to any

one of Southern Water’s 5000+ sites.

Southern Water is one of the largest water utility companies in the South East supplying over a million homes with

clean, fresh drinking water as well as treating and recycling wastewater from nearly two million households across

Sussex, Kent, Hampshire and the Isle of Wight.

Partner focus - ABB

www.mke.co.uk

In 1988 ASEA – one of Sweden’s oldest electrical engineering companies – merged with Brown Boveri & Cie (BBC) – one of Switzerland’s longest established engineering conglomerates. The venture created ABB and brought together a diverse range of technologies that had been shaping the world since 1883. Between them, the two companies had invented the steam turbine, turbochargers, the gas turbine, HVDC, gearless motors drives, gas-insulated

switchgear, the industrial robot, variable-speed drives and most recently, extended operator workstations. ABB now stands as a global leader in power and automation technologies. MKE’s relationship with ABB stems from two areas of our business – electric motors & variable speed drives, the benefits of which are relayed to customers through our participation in the ABB Motor Service Partners and ABB Drives Alliance networks. As a member of these two networks, MKE is authorised to advise

upon & supply market leading ABB motors and variable-speed drives as well as act as a certified repair centre. Whether the requirement is installation or maintenance, retrofit or replacement, MKE is able to assist, supported by ABB’s range of leading edge, energy efficient products. Energy efficiency is of critical importance in the current economic climate, and ABB products lead the way in providing the latest IE2 energy efficient electric motors. Couple this with a variable speed drive and the reduced energy consumption and related cost savings can be considerable, between 20-50% compared to fixed speed, with payback often within 2 years. In 2011 alone, ABB drives were reported to save a record 310 megawatts hours of energy, equivalent to the yearly equivalent of 75 million households in the EU.
